Avi Press - Founder & CEO at Scarf

Talking Points:
- Open-source contributions
- Working with workflows
- Promoting open-source projects
- Networking
- Founder’s mindset
Quotable Quotes:
- "Getting involved with open-source can definitely make your development more visible" - AP
- "A lot of the opportunities that I've had in my life often come down to networking, and open-source is no exception to that" – AP
"I've always generally been a proponent of just being exposed to lots of different ways to thinking or ways of working, that makes you more adaptable" – AP - "That was really kind of the start of it [open-source] for me, just having tools I was building and using myself" – AP
- "[Canonical advice for getting started on open-source] Find a smallish but still used project, use it, try to use it in something, figure out where the gaps are in either documentation or tests or examples […] and do a small (as small as you can) PR" – DG
- "[Another approach] Trying to do your own project and see what it's like to sort of packaging all up and trying to have like a very complete but again small project that checks all the boxes" – DG
- "Go talk to people, go ask" – AP
- "It doesn't matter how busy a person is if you very genuinely just ask [to connect with them]" – AP
- "Think about who may be the dream person that you’d want to go to for advice and then just try it" – AP
- "I think that just about everyone should care about the other parts of the business where you work" – AP
